| Content and context |
Sir James Parker was born in 1803, the son of Charles Steuart Parker of Blockairn. He was educated at Glasgow Grammar School and Trinity College, Cambridge, BA 1825; MA 1828. Barrister at Lincoln's Inn, 1829; Q.C. 1844; Vice-Chancellor, 1851. He was knighted in 1851. Parker was married Mary, third daughter of Thomas Babington of Rothley Temple in 1829. He died in 1852. |
